Awesome day so far.

Car picked us up at 4:45 and we were at Westchester County Airport by 5:15. I had printed the boarding passes yesterday so we just needed to check the 3 bags which took less than 5 minutes. We as our breakfast which Aladdin and Hercules got a the neighborhood deli and then went through security which was a breeze. We were on the plane at 6 for the 6:30 flight, but took off 12 minutes late due to "congestion in the area." Still landed 19 minutes early at 8:50. After a quick restroom break we made if to the ME line by 9:15.

There were no buses there when we arrived. Not one! But none of the lines were long. More later, gtg!

Back at ME 9:15 am. Several lines but no buses. The first bus came a few minutes later and a bunch came in a row. They seemed to toad the lines in order from longest to shortest. Seemed very well organized. Our line was for all MK resorts. When we boarded our bus at 9:32, the driver said first stop would be Poly, followed by GF, WL, then finally CR/BLT. We arrived at the Poly by 10:10.

We went straight to the on-line check-in line, where we were welcomed with leis and alohas. We were given our packet which included happy anniversary buttons for Aladdin and me and a birthday button for Belle. We were laughing about poor Hercules getting no button, and they immediately gave him an "I'm celebrating" button. Very sweet!

Our room wasn't ready but we were told it was in Samoa. I asked if it would be on the volcano pool side 3rd floor and our CM said yes! That's when we started bouncing! Requests met! He said the room probably wouldn't be ready until 3. We requested a text message when ready. It took a total of 5 minutes to check in. We were done by 10:15.
